The Proposed Changes to the Colombia Pension System
The proposed Colombia Pension Reform aims to restructure the country's pension system, primarily addressing the sustainability of the existing model. The core elements of the reform include significant changes to the roles and responsibilities of various stakeholders.
-
Changes to private pension fund management (AFP): The reform proposes significant alterations to how private pension funds (AFP) operate, potentially increasing regulation and oversight to enhance transparency and accountability. This includes stricter guidelines on investment strategies and more robust protection for pensioner contributions. The debate centers around the balance between private sector efficiency and government regulation in managing retirement savings.
-
Impact on contribution rates: The proposed changes may affect the contribution rates for both employers and employees. Discussions involve adjusting these rates to ensure the long-term financial viability of the system, a crucial aspect of the Colombia Pension Reform debate. These adjustments are a key area of contention, with concerns about increasing the burden on workers already struggling with the cost of living.
-
Changes to the minimum pension guarantee: The reform seeks to modify the minimum pension guarantee, impacting the level of support provided to low-income retirees. Debates rage over the adequacy of the proposed guarantee and whether it adequately addresses the needs of vulnerable populations. This is a central point of concern for many opponents of the reform.
-
Projected long-term effects on government spending: The reform's projected impact on government spending is a subject of ongoing analysis. Critics point to potential increases in government expenditure, while proponents argue the reform will promote long-term fiscal sustainability. Understanding the long-term financial implications is crucial for evaluating the reform's effectiveness.
-
Comparison to existing systems in other Latin American countries: Comparisons with pension systems in other Latin American countries, such as Chile or Argentina, are frequently cited in the debate. Analyzing the successes and failures of similar reforms in other nations provides valuable context for assessing the potential impact of the Colombia Pension Reform. These comparisons often highlight the complexities and challenges inherent in pension system reform.
Specific Corruption Allegations and their Sources
Several credible sources have reported allegations of corruption surrounding the Colombia Pension Reform. These allegations raise serious questions about the integrity of the legislative process and the potential for undue influence by private interests.
-
Allegations of bribery or lobbying by private sector actors: News reports and investigations by NGOs suggest that private sector actors, including those involved in the AFP system, may have engaged in bribery or intensive lobbying efforts to influence the design and passage of the reform. These allegations, while requiring further investigation, are a significant cause for public concern.
-
Evidence of conflicts of interest within government agencies involved in the reform process: Reports indicate potential conflicts of interest among government officials involved in drafting and approving the reform. Such conflicts raise concerns about the impartiality of the process and the potential for decisions to be influenced by personal gain rather than public interest.
-
Lack of transparency in the legislative process surrounding the reform: Critics cite a lack of transparency throughout the legislative process, highlighting the need for greater public access to information and greater opportunities for public consultation. This lack of transparency fuels public distrust and suspicion.
-
Mention of specific individuals or entities implicated in the allegations: While naming specific individuals at this stage might be premature without conclusive evidence, several news outlets have alluded to specific individuals and entities whose actions warrant further investigation.
Public Response and Protests Against the Colombia Pension Reform
The proposed Colombia Pension Reform and the accompanying corruption allegations have provoked widespread public outrage and significant protests.
-
Details of organized protests and demonstrations: Large-scale protests and demonstrations have been organized across the country, expressing public discontent with the reform and demanding greater transparency and accountability. These protests are a clear indication of the depth of public opposition.
-
Public opinion polls and surveys regarding the reform: Public opinion polls consistently show a high level of disapproval for the proposed reform. This widespread dissatisfaction underscores the urgency for addressing the concerns of Colombian citizens.
-
Statements from labor unions and civil society organizations: Labor unions and numerous civil society organizations have issued strongly worded statements condemning the reform and calling for its revision or withdrawal. Their involvement further highlights the scale of public opposition.
-
Coverage by Colombian media outlets: The Colombian media has extensively covered the controversy surrounding the reform and the corruption allegations. This extensive media coverage has played a vital role in raising public awareness and fueling public debate.
Potential Long-Term Impacts of the Corruption Scandal on the Colombia Pension Reform
The corruption allegations surrounding the Colombia Pension Reform could have far-reaching and long-lasting consequences for the nation.
-
Potential delays or complete abandonment of the reform: The scandal could lead to significant delays or even the complete abandonment of the proposed reform, leaving the existing pension system vulnerable to its inherent challenges.
-
Erosion of public trust in the government: The corruption allegations undermine public trust in the government's ability to act in the best interests of its citizens, exacerbating existing political instability.
-
Impact on Colombia's economic stability and investor confidence: The scandal could negatively impact Colombia's economic stability and investor confidence, potentially hindering economic growth and investment in the country.
-
Possible legal challenges to the reform: The allegations may result in legal challenges to the reform, potentially delaying its implementation or leading to its modification or annulment.
